The judge files the criminal case against the bus driver of the Freginals accident

The magistrate of Criminal Court No. 1 of Tortosa has closed the criminal proceedings opened in 2016 against the driver of the bus that crashed in Freginals (Montsià), on the AP-7, where 13 Erasmus students died. The judicial decision comes as a result of the natural death of the driver, two weeks ago.

The driver was the only person accused by criminal proceedings and the Prosecutor's Office asked him for four years in prison for thirteen alleged crimes of reckless homicide. The indictment, which is now without effect, reasoned that the driver disregarded safety regulations. The prosecution argued that the driver got behind the wheel of the bus knowing that he was tired and sleepy when he was preparing to return from the Fallas in Valencia, in March 2016, in the direction of Barcelona. His driving was erratic for many minutes, with braking and hitting the steering wheel, before the accident occurred.

The bus ended up overturning on the AP-7 motorway, at dawn, as it passed through Freginals. Thirteen Erasmus students, seven of them Italian, lost their lives almost instantly. About twenty suffered injuries. The bus driver was seriously injured but was able to recover. Two weeks ago he suffered a heart attack and passed away.

The victims were part of a group of students from the University of Barcelona (UB) who had traveled to experience the Fallas in Valencia.

The insurance company has already compensated the families of the victims, through civil proceedings. The families of the victims continued as a private prosecution through criminal proceedings that have now been closed, without any option of recourse, due to the sudden death of the driver.

The judicial investigation was opened in 2016, after the accident, but the investigation has been delayed over time for various reasons. It was archived three different times at the hands of the three judges who have investigated the criminal case. Until, finally, as a result of the appeals of the private accusations and the prosecution, the Tarragona Court reopened the case in October 2019. Now only the oral trial was pending with the driver as the only defendant.
